CEO Strategic Leadership Series
The automotive industry is entering the most consequential transition in its history. Electrification, autonomous systems, AI-driven supply chains, and shifting global trade dynamics are redefining competitive strategy. North American manufacturers face rising capital demands, volatile markets, software-first competition, and regulatory uncertainty. For CEOs, the challenge is not only adapting — but reshaping their organizations to thrive in a future defined by mobility ecosystems, digital platforms, and new revenue models. This series explores the pressures and opportunities reshaping automotive value chains and outlines strategic pathways for executives preparing their organizations for the next decade of rapid transformation.
